The Institute of Electrical Engineers of Japan (IEEJ) (Japanese: 電気学会) is a scientific and professional organization based in Tokyo, Japan. The organization was founded in 1888. It has more than 23,000 members, including scientists, engineers and students.[1] The institute specialises in the areas of materials, power and energy, electronics, information and systems, sensors and micromachines and other.
